Keltron launched its ID Card Project (IDCP) in 1991 seeing an opportunity in the decision by the Election Commission of India to provide Electoral Photo Identity Cards to the voting population of India. Keltron was then in possession of the right technologies and the right people to carry out this mission. Today, IDCP is identified as the State Level Agency of the Chief Electoral Officer of Kerala. In addition to providing ID cards for the entire voting public of Kerala, IDCP also maintains the Electoral Rolls Management System of the State.

IDCP maintains 77 Touch Screen Kiosks in every district and Taluk Offices in Kerala for providing online verification facility of electoral rolls by the public.

Keltron is presently in the process of converting the electoral database located at 140 LACs to a single database. This precedes the creation of a central database of electors for each State which would be integrated into a national database.

For the first time in India, an Interactive Voice Response System (IVRS) enabling the public to verify the electoral rolls over telephone has been designed and developed by IDCP in 2002.

IDCP also produces various types of Cards such as SMART Cards, RFID Cards, Bar Coded Cards, Employee Identity, Traders Identity, Beneficiary Identity, Driving License, Ration Cards as per customer requirement.
